The loss of cadmium and zinc from solutions contained in glass and polystyrene vessels has been determined at different metal concentrations (0.2–3 μg ml?1). A substantial amount (37%) of cadmium was lost after 15 days, while 4% zinc was lost after 50 h. In view of this metal loss, it is stressed that interpretation of graphs, calculations and deductions cannot be made on the basis of spiking amounts alone. It is also suggested that in accumulation experiments use should be made of precontaminated apparatus and the fate of metals for each experiment must be monitored separately. These precautions were omitted in 62% of all papers dealing with metal pollution published by one serious biological journal in 1979. This greatly reduces the value of the reported results and conclusions. Similarly, many earlier papers and reviews reporting acute toxicity concentrations should be viewed with extreme caution. 相似文献

The ultraviolet spectra of samples of an oil pollutant and crude oil at various concentrations were examined. Strong absorption maxima appear at approximately 228 nm and 256 nm. These permit a quantitative analysis in polluted sediment samples many months after the spill. Results obtained from three visits to an oil polluted beach on the South coast of South Africa are reported. 相似文献
